Christian B. Anfinsen (March 26, 1916 – May 14, 1995) was an American biochemist. He shared the 1972 Nobel Prize in Chemistry for his seminal work on ribonuclease, specifically linking its amino acid sequence to its active biological shape. His contributions advanced the understanding of protein folding.

Major Achievements and Career Highlights

A defining moment in Christian B. Anfinsen's career came in 1972 when he was awarded the Nobel Prize in Chemistry. He shared this esteemed honor with Stanford Moore and William Howard Stein. The Nobel Committee recognized his crucial work on ribonuclease, particularly his insights into the relationship between an enzyme's amino acid sequence and its biologically active conformation. This recognition solidified his standing as a leading figure in biochemical research.

Legacy and Impact

Christian B. Anfinsen's research fundamentally altered the understanding of how proteins achieve their three-dimensional structures. His work on ribonuclease provided direct experimental proof that the amino acid sequence dictates the protein's folded state, a concept now known as Anfinsen's dogma. This discovery laid crucial groundwork for molecular biology and biochemistry, influencing subsequent research into diseases caused by protein misfolding. His intellectual contributions continue to inform and inspire generations of scientists exploring the complex world of biological molecules.
